International Geotechnics: Gruner Keeps Track of Tomorrow’s Trends

International professional conferences are important platforms for knowledge transfer and innovation. By participating in the 21st International Conference on Soil Mechanics and Geotechnical Engineering (ICSMGE 2026) in Vienna, Gruner will gain first-hand insights into the latest developments in geotechnical engineering, strengthen international networks, and contribute to the event with its own technical presentation.

From 14 to 19 June 2026, experts from academia, engineering, and construction practice from around the world will gather in Vienna for the 21st International Conference on Soil Mechanics and Geotechnical Engineering (ICSMGE 2026). The event is one of the most important international conferences in geotechnical engineering and provides a platform for discussing current challenges and future developments in the industry.

Key topics include sustainable infrastructure, tunnelling and specialist foundation engineering, adaptation to changing environmental conditions, as well as innovative technologies and methods for underground construction. For Gruner, the conference offers an opportunity to gain new scientific insights and learn about international best practices while exchanging ideas with experts from different countries and disciplines.

Driving Innovation for Our Clients’ Projects

Laurent Pitteloud, Head of Geotechnical Department, and Dr. Jörg Meier, Senior Project Manager in Geotechnics, will represent Gruner at the conference. Laurent Pitteloud will also contribute to the international exchange of knowledge with a technical presentation. In his talk, he will demonstrate how innovative modelling approaches can support the efficient analysis and design of complex geotechnical structures in seismic regions. The conference therefore not only promotes professional exchange but also provides valuable inspiration for the further development of geotechnical solutions.

From Training Centre to Housing: Re-Use as a Design Principle for Sustainable Construction

In Arlesheim (BL), the former Baloise training centre is being transformed into around 64 rental apartments. The Hagenbündten project, currently under construction, demonstrates how consistent re-use strategies can create sustainable housing within existing structures.

Bridge installed over the A2 in just 30 minutes

Gruner was responsible for the design and construction management of the new pedestrian and cyclist bridge in Härkingen in the fields of bridge engineering, road construction and civil engineering. For the bridge lift, the A2 motorway was closed for just 30 minutes – a glimpse into a demanding night-time operation.
